Wed 10 Sep 2003 12:12:37 AM UTC, original submission:

Editing the admin user from a .16 install from several weeks ago that has no First name or Last name (.14 allows this too so upgrades may also be a problem) will not save. The Last Name is always tried as NULL no matter what I type in.

Database error: Invalid SQL: INSERT INTO phpgw_contact_person (prefix, first_name, last_name, created_on, created_by, modified_on, modified_by, person_id) VALUES ('epcadmin', 'Admin', NULL , '1', '1', '1', '1', '10')
MySQL Error: 1048 (Column 'last_name' cannot be null)

Tried many different things for Lastname, it always tried to insert NULL.
